MBP 17" Best Harddrive (speed & space)
Im looking into buying a new harddrive for my macbook pro 17" at least 300 GB
looking into something thats about 500 Gb or 1 TB but i still want good speed also which is more reliable already searched didnt find this in the other topics Thanks in advance |

well you have several options.... first, i would wait until at least jan. 5th to purchase a 17" MBP. They are going to be upgrading them on that date. Second.... If you want to have wicked speed you have several options....
320GB hard drive @ 7200 rpm 2nd 320 GB hard drive @ 7200 rpm in an optibay enclosure (google MCE Tech) you set those up in a Raid 0 and it'll be ridiculous. personally i would go for that option. or just throw a 500 gb hard drive in it from western digital and call it a day. Don't expect to get these options from apple though. |
